Transaction 38d10a31725eacbebf97fbf76ebdcae7ace98c175697bdb260c7c2d6d75482c2

2 Input
2 Outputs
  • 38d10a31725eacbebf97fbf76ebdcae7ace98c175697bdb260c7c2d6d75482c2:0
  • value  65574
    address  3FoMjW16RPQKGmmuwKtWCJeWJ9syaKzDJg
  • 38d10a31725eacbebf97fbf76ebdcae7ace98c175697bdb260c7c2d6d75482c2:1
  • value  3547851
    address  12tfpvwssS36jthZ4SyS3Yd1vMG6LYJeza